<p>jest-resolve gagal menyelesaikan file json</p>

Dibuat pada 4 Apr 2017  ·  3Komentar  ·  Sumber: facebook/jest

Apakah Anda ingin meminta fitur atau melaporkan bug ? serangga

Apa perilaku saat ini?
Saat ini ketika ada dependensi yang require .json file, dan tidak secara eksplisit menentukan jenis .json (tidak yakin apakah itu penting), jest-resolve melempar kesalahan sebagai berikut :

 FAIL  src\lint\lint-sass\lint-sass.spec.ts
  ● Test suite failed to run

    Cannot find module './data/all' from 'index.js'

      at Resolver.resolveModule (node_modules\jest-resolve\build\index.js:169:17)
      at Object.<anonymous> (node_modules\known-css-properties\index.js:1:111)

Ini adalah perpustakaan yang melempar kesalahan
https://github.com/betit/known-css-properties/blob/master/index.js#L1 (dan impornya dari file json), juga mendapatkan masalah yang sama dari normalize-package-data

Saat ini saya sedang mengganti perpustakaan dari menggunakan melati (juga sebagai pelari) menjadi lelucon. Ini telah terjadi di 2 perpustakaan (ketergantungan dari ketergantungan)

Apa perilaku yang diharapkan?
Saya percaya bahwa impor seperti itu harus berfungsi dengan benar karena berfungsi di simpul dan juga di pelari melati.
secara pribadi saya tidak akan menggunakan file json di tempat pertama tapi itu cerita lain :)

Harap berikan konfigurasi Jest Anda yang tepat dan sebutkan Jest, node, versi yarn/npm dan sistem operasi Anda.

  • Lelucon: 19.0.2
  • simpul: 7.8.0
  • NPM: 4.4.4
  • Windows 7

Komentar yang paling membantu

Semua 3 komentar

@thymikee tepatnya, itu memperbaikinya!

Saya telah mencari cukup banyak dan tidak menemukannya :(
Tidak yakin apakah itu didokumentasikan di mana saja tetapi saya butuh beberapa waktu untuk mencari tahu apa yang salah sejak awal.

@thymikee banyak terima kasih, terutama untuk balasan super cepat :+1:

Senang itu membantu! 🙂

Apakah halaman ini membantu?
0 / 5 - 0 peringkat